Master of Science in Applied Economic Analysis at University of Bern Entry Requirements

- The following academic qualifications are required for admission to the specialized master’s degree program in Applied Economic Analysis (mono):
- Bachelor's degree from a Swiss university in the branch of studies Economics
- Bachelor's degree from a Swiss university with at least 60 ECTS credits in the branch of studies Economics
- Bachelor's degree from a Swiss university with at least 30 ECTS credits in the branch of studies Economics (this must include coursework in the subjects of Econometrics, Microeconomics and Macroeconomics, each with a minimum grade of 5.0)
- Bachelor's degree from a recognized foreign university with an equivalent qualification entitles students to admission in accordance with the recommendation made by the Study Committee.
- India specific requirement-university degree (minimum duration of study: 3 years full-time)

Master of Science in Applied Economic Analysis at University of Bern Highlights
- Our graduates are able to use the appropriate theoretical concepts, empirical methods and data to analyze applied questions relevant for economic policy making, private and public investment decisions and business strategy.
- The Master in Applied Economic Analysis at the University of Bern is the first university-level program in Switzerland that is specifically aimed at teaching these skills.
- It provides a unique combination of state-of-the-art theoretical and methodological courses and regular applications to real-world cases. With an internationally renowned faculty, close ties to the capital city’s political decision makers as well as to the business community, the University of Bern is ideally placed to offer such a program.
